错误#1 16:28 2012-7-25
数据库服务器A想开启下sql server 2000的AWE。结果发现在查询分析器中执行RECONFIGURE时报错。运行的语句为:

 sp_configure 'show advanced options',1
reconfigure
go
sp_configure 'awe enabled',1
reconfigure
go
sp_configure 'max server memory',4096
reconfigure
go

报错信息:
已将配置选项 'show advanced options' 从 1 改为 1。请运行 RECONFIGURE 语句以安装。
服务器: 消息 5808,级别 16,状态 1,行 2
建议不要对系统目录进行特殊更新。请用 RECONFIGURE WITH OVERRIDE 语句来强制实施这一配置
解答#1 --查看配置信息
select * from sysconfigures order by config
allow updates to system tables对应的value为1(允许更新选项设置为 1 时,不能直接更新系统表)
解决方案一:依据提示信息用RECONFIGURE WITH OVERRIDE
方案二:将allow updates to system tables对应的值修改为0

 sp_configure 'show advanced options',1
reconfigure with override

查看系统是否开启AWE

 --查看系统是否开启AWE
sp_configure 'show advanced options',1
reconfigure with override
go
sp_configure 'awe enabled'--返回的run_value为1表示已经开启了AWE
或者在日志信息中看到下面的语句也表示成功开启了AWE
2012-06-28 10:05:15.32 server Address Windowing Extensions enabled.

错误#2 11:15 2012-7-26
在性能日志与警报中,计数器日志下,添加新的日志设置
如果添加的计数器中包括SQLSERVER的计数器,在事件查看器应用程序下会有很多类似下面的错误
Windows 无法加载可扩展计数器 DLL MSSQL$SQL2000,数据段中的第一个 DWORD 是 Windows 错误码。
服务未能将计数器 '\\SERVERNAME\MSSQL$SQL2000:Buffer Manager\Lazy writes/ sec' 添加到 test 日志或警报。这个日志或警报将继续,但是那个计数器的数据将不会被收集。 返回的错误是: 在系统上找不到指定的对象。

SQLSERVER的性能计数器 http://www.ixpub.net/thread-839785-1-1.html
In command line执行以下命令

 unlodctr MSSQLServer
cd C:\Program Files\Microsoft SQL Server\MSSQL\BINN
lodctr sqlctr.ini
net stop mssqlserver
net start mssqlserver

参照以上方法修改后结果还是一样,只是在系统监视器下面添加SQLSERVER的计数器,不会有错误信息。
解答#2 15:04 2012-7-31
通过搜索SysmonLog得到其对应Performance Logs and Alerts服务,正是收集性能信息的服务。查看其登录用户,默认为内置用户NT Authority\NetworkService
SQL Server服务登录身份为administrator
解决思路:需使Performance Logs and Alerts服务的登录帐户具有对SQL计数器 DLL(sqlctr80.dll,SQL2000)的读取运行权限http://bbs.csdn.net/topics/230001027
其一:修改Performance Logs and Alerts服务的登录帐户为administrator

AWE、加载计数器错误的更多相关文章

  1. 【Android】Bitmap加载图片错误 java.lang.OutOfMemoryError: bitmap size exceeds VM budget

    今天测试程序的时候出现下面的错误日志信息,程序当场挂掉 07-09 14:11:25.434: W/System.err(4890): java.lang.OutOfMemoryError: bitm ...

  2. php基础语法(文件加载和错误)

    文件加载 有4个文件加载的语法形式(注意,不是函数): include,  include_once,  require, require_once; 他们的本质是一样的,都是用于加载/引入/包含/载 ...

  3. php文件加载、错误处理、方法函数和数组

    数组运算符注意:php中,数组的元素的顺序,不是由下标(键名)决定的,而是完全由加入的顺序来决定.联合(+):将右边的数组项合并到左边数组的后面,得到一个新数组.如有重复键,则结果以左边的为准$v1 ...

  4. Flash Builder中“Error: #2036 加载未完成”错误的解决方法

    复制了一个名称为A的widget包,重命名为B,包含B.mxml和B.xml(配置文件),编译后无法加载B包创建的widget,报错为: 解决办法: 1.在工程的根目录下找到.actionScript ...

  5. c++ 加载库错误问题解决

    转载自:http://blog.csdn.net/sahusoft/article/details/7388617 一般我们在Linux下执行某些外部程序的时候可能会提示找不到共享库的错误, 比如: ...

  6. NHibernate加载DLL错误

    这几天在开发关于Rest的服务,其中用到了NHibernate来进行数据库交互,突然有一天发现了一个错误,如下: Could not load file or assembly 'NHibernate ...

  7. php cli 模式下执行文件,require 加载路径错误

    今天,同事突然告诉我,我写的一个做计划任务的php脚本执行总是不成功. 脚本本身很简单,里面只有包含了几个库文件并执行了一个函数,函数应该没有错误,这个函数在别处也调用过,没有问题.我在本地用浏览器访 ...

  8. dojo加载树错误

    1.错误叙述性说明    error loading undefined children.    TypeError:this._arrayOfTopLevelItems is undefied. ...

  9. IIS 加载 JSON 错误 404 解决办法

    MIME设置:在IIS的站点属性的HTTP头设置里,选MIME 映射中点击”文件类型”-”新类型”,添加一个文件类型:关联扩展名:*.json内容类型(MIME):application/x-java ...

随机推荐

  1. yii uploadfile 错误提示: fileinfo php extension is not installed

    rule规则里面增加 'checkExtensionByMimeType'=>false,

  2. [办公自动化]skydrive onedrive

    国内暂时无法访问onedrive,请按如下步骤操作尝试:依次如下:在开始菜单里,单击“所有程序”,找到“附件”,单击找到里面的“记事本”,右键,然后选择“以管理员身份运行”,如果有对话框,选择“是”. ...

  3. [ZZ] The Naked Truth About Anisotropic Filtering

    http://www.extremetech.com/computing/51994-the-naked-truth-about-anisotropic-filtering In the seemin ...

  4. centos7 安装mysql5.7及配置

    一.Mysql 各个版本区别:1.MySQL Community Server 社区版本,开源免费,但不提供官方技术支持.2.MySQL Enterprise Edition 企业版本,需付费,可以试 ...

  5. 去除GHOST版系统自带的2345流氓软件

    话说2345真心流氓  用户想用你 自然不会删你 你这样强制性的 反而引起反感 应该是软件劫持性的捆绑 所以非常难起清除 最方便的方法就是 下载个 黄山IE修复专家   先把IE修复好 然后删除预安装 ...

  6. java--接口和抽象类

    接口将抽象类的概念更延伸了一步,完全禁止了所有的函数定义.且可以将多个接口合并到一起,但是不能继承多个类.

  7. IOS 移除storyboard

    我是IOS新手,都说storyboard是个好东西,但是我搞了一会始终没有搞懂,并且我觉得学习一门语言,使用类似以前网页三剑客这种所见所得工具,不太利于学习,所以我就想着移除storyboard 1: ...

  8. JQuery..bind命名空间

    先看手册,由于bind方法有三个参数(type,[data],fn),所以手册上这么介绍: .bind() 方法是用于往文档上附加行为的主要方式.所有JavaScript事件对象, 比如focus, ...

  9. ASP.Net网站程序在编译发布部署后的后期修改

    ASP.Net网站程序在发布部署后的后期修改 作者:东篱南山 这里说的后期修改是指网站编译发布并部署好之后,对程序进行的修改,即在不能更改现有代码的情况下,更改页面的显示或是更改业务逻辑.一般是在程序 ...

  10. ASP.NET网页生成EXCEL并下载(利用DataGrid或GridView等)

    前几天要在后台查询数据库内容(用entity framework),将查询出来的信息(List或DataTable形式)转成EXCEL供用户下载.经过谷歌.百度搜索,终于搜出了一些代码.似乎可用了,结 ...